[TOC] #### 1. 环境准备 --- 在安装 ThinkPHP 6.0 之前,需要先检查下当前环境,是否满足要求 + ThinkPHP 6.0 要求 PHP >= 7.2.5 + 将 PHP 的安装路径配置到系统环境变量 `Path` 中 + 开启 pdo_mysql、mb_string、openssl 等常用扩展,下载并安装Composer 通过 `composer` 下载 TinkPHP 官方发布的最新正式版 + tp6:目录名,省略时默认为项目名称 + topthink/think:供应商名称/项目名称 ```bash composer create-project topthink/think='6.0.*' tp6 ```  #### 2. 虚拟域名 --- 我的环境是单独装的,没有用集成环境。环境组成:Apahce2.4 + PHP7.3 + MySQL5.7 修改 apache 虚拟机主机文件,如果没有开启 Apache 的重写模块,需要先开启 打开文件 `E:\Apache24\conf\extra\httpd-vhosts.conf` 添加以下内容 `特别注意:运行目录指向public目录,而不是框架根目录` ```plaintext <VirtualHost *:80> DocumentRoot "E:\www\thinkphp\tp6\public" ServerName tp6.cy </VirtualHost> ``` 打开文件 `C:\Windows\System32\drivers\etc\hosts` 在文件底部添加以下内容 ```plaintext 127.0.0.1 tp6.cy ``` 重启 Apache 服务 ```plaintext 按下 window + r --> 输入 services.msc --> 回车 找到 Apache2.4 点击左侧的 "重启动" ```  #### 3. 测试访问 --- 浏览器地址栏输入刚才配置的虚拟机域名 tp6.cy 